President Isaac Herzog met with Rahm Emanuel in Jerusalem earlier today, as The Zioneer reported. Following the meeting, Emanuel reportedly stated that Arab states' push for regional stability, Israel's security needs, and Palestinian self-determination could be combined within a single diplomatic framework. The remarks add detail to the encounter, which was first reported at 14:59 Jerusalem time. Emanuel, a former senior Obama administration official and potential 2028 presidential candidate, offered the framework as a way to bridge competing interests.
